Skip to content

Class mediapipe::api2::InputShardAccess

template <typename T>

ClassList > mediapipe > api2 > InputShardAccess

Inherits the following classes: mediapipe::api2::Packet< T >

Public Functions

Type Name
absl::StatusOr< std::unique_ptr< U > > Consume ()
absl::StatusOr< std::unique_ptr< V > > Consume ()
auto ConsumeAndVisit (F &&... args)
PacketBase Header () const
bool IsConnected () const
bool IsDone () const
const PacketBase & packet () const
PacketBase packet () const

Public Functions Documentation

function Consume [1/2]

template<class U, class>
inline absl::StatusOr< std::unique_ptr< U > > mediapipe::api2::InputShardAccess::Consume () 

function Consume [2/2]

template<class V, class U, std::enable_if_t< internal::IsCompatibleType< V, U >{}, int >>
inline absl::StatusOr< std::unique_ptr< V > > mediapipe::api2::InputShardAccess::Consume () 

function ConsumeAndVisit

template<class... F>
inline auto mediapipe::api2::InputShardAccess::ConsumeAndVisit (
    F &&... args
) 

function Header

inline PacketBase mediapipe::api2::InputShardAccess::Header () const

function IsConnected

inline bool mediapipe::api2::InputShardAccess::IsConnected () const

function IsDone

inline bool mediapipe::api2::InputShardAccess::IsDone () const

function packet [1/2]

inline const PacketBase & mediapipe::api2::InputShardAccess::packet () const

function packet [2/2]

inline PacketBase mediapipe::api2::InputShardAccess::packet () const


The documentation for this class was generated from the following file /home/friedel/devel/ILLIXR-plugins/hand_tracking/mediapipe/framework/api/port.h